Frequently asked questions

How far is the unit from Melbourne’s central business district?

Elwood is about 8 km south‑east of Melbourne’s CBD, so the unit at 5/358 Barkly Street is roughly an 8‑kilometre commute to the city centre.

What public transport options are available near the property?

The location is served by several bus routes, including the 630, 923 and 246 lines, and tram route 67 runs along nearby Brighton Road. The nearest train stations, Ripponlea and Elsternwick, are just beyond the suburb’s northern boundary.

Which beaches or waterfront areas are close to the unit?

Elwood Beach, a popular bayside spot for swimming, windsurfing and walking, is within a short walk, and the Elwood Canal is also nearby, both offering easy access to the waterfront.

What local amenities and cultural venues are within walking distance?

Within about 0.4–0.8 km you’ll find the Elwood Post Office, Elwood Police Station, Phoenix Theatre, and the historic Elwood Talmud Torah Hebrew Congregation, as well as a range of cafés and shops along New Street and Ormond Road.

How would you describe the architectural style of the neighbourhood?

Elwood features a mix of Victorian mansions, Edwardian cottages and interwar apartment buildings, giving the area a heritage‑rich streetscape that blends historic charm with more recent infill developments.

Are there any parks or green spaces nearby for recreation?

The suburb’s largest open spaces include the bayside reserves of Elwood Beach, the Elwood Canal and Point Ormond Reserve, all located within 1 km of the unit.
